How bad do Basenjis shed?

How bad do Basenjis shed? Basenjis are considered a low shedding breed. Like most dogs, they do shed more during seasonal changes like Spring, but it’s not very noticeable given their short coat, and they’re very easy to groom. Who is most affected by secondhand smoke?

Who is most affected by secondhand smoke? Children still have a higher prevalence of secondhand smoke exposure than adults, and most are exposed in the home.
